Year 4 Multiplication Times Tables Check 2022

(28 children in the cohort – 26 children took the test with 2 children unable to access the test  due to working below expectation)

Percentage of pupils who achieved 25/25 marks:

12/26 – 46%

(Cohort 28 – 12/28 – 43%)

Percentage of pupils who achieved 21/25 marks or more:

21/26 – 81%

(Cohort 28 – 21/28 – 75%)

Mean score for cohort:

Children who took the test (26) mean score – 23

Cohort 28 – mean score 21
